Tom and his best friend are going to join a gym. Tom saw that Platinum gym has a sale with a one time fee of $90 and a monthly f
worty [1.4K]

Answer:

<u>Part 1:</u>

For Platinum Gym:

90 + 30x

For Super Fit Gym:

200 + 20x

<u>Part 2:</u>  $270

<u>Part 3:</u>  $320

<u>Part 4:</u>  11 months

<u>Part 5:</u>  See explanation below

Step-by-step explanation:

<u>Part 1:</u>

Let "x" be the number of months:

For Platinum Gym:

90 + 30x

For Super Fit Gym:

200 + 20x

<u>Part 2:</u>

We put x = 6 in platinum gym's equation and get our answer.

90 + 30x

90 + 30(6)

90 + 180

=$270

<u>Part 3:</u>

We put x = 6 into super fit's equation and get our answer.

200 + 20x

200 + 20(6)

200 + 120

=$320

<u>Part 4:</u>

To find the number of months for both gyms to cost same, we need to equate both equations and solve for x:

90 + 30x = 200 + 20x

10x = 110

x = 11

So 11 months

<u>Part 5:</u>

We know for 11 months, they will cost same. Let's check for 10 months and 12 months.

In 10 months:

Platinum = 90 + 30(10) = 390

Super Fit = 200 + 20(10) = 400

In 12 months:

Platinum = 90 + 30(12) = 450

Super Fit = 200 + 20(12) = 440

Thus, we can see that Platinum Gym is a better deal if you want to get membership for months less than 11 and Super Fit is a better deal if you want to get membership for months greater than 11.
